Third grade will be a special year for your child because it is the beginning of the intermediate grades. Students entering third grade can expect a lot of changes. This year students will learn many new skills, including note-taking and cursive writing. Also students are now eligible for honor roll and can participate in school sports. Report cards will also be different, as students are now assessed using the traditional grading scale. I look forward to seeing you all at our back to school night on Wednesday, September 3rd. Over the summer students were given both math and reading assignments.

In math students were expected to practice the following skills: addition and subtraction of three digit numbers (with regrouping); addition facts with sums up to 18; and writing four digit numbers in word form.
